Devils vs. Capitals Betting Insights
- New Jersey's games this season have finished above this matchup's total of 5.5 goals 16 times.
- Washington's games this season have had over 5.5 goals 20 of 37 times.
- These teams score 5.9 goals per game combined, 0.4 more than this game's total.
- These two teams allow 5.6 goals per game combined, 0.1 more than the total for this game.
- The Capitals are eighth in the league in goals scored, compared to the 26th-ranked Devils.
- This match features the league's fifth-ranked (Capitals) and 14th-ranked (Devils) teams in terms of defense.
Devils Stats
- The Devils' 100 total goals (2.7 per game) rank 26th in the league.
- New Jersey ranks 14th in goals against, giving up 110 total goals (3.0 per game) in NHL action.
- Their -10 goal differential ranks 24th in the league.
- The 19 power-play goals New Jersey has recorded this season rank 21st in the NHL (on 92 chances).
- The Devils rank 11th in the league with a 20.65% power-play conversion rate.
- New Jersey has scored four shorthanded goals this season.

Capitals Stats
- With 117 goals (3.2 per game), the Capitals have the league's eighth-best offense.
- Washington's total of 99 goals allowed (2.7 per game) is fifth-best in the league.
- Their +18 goal differential is fourth-best in the league.
- Washington has 16 power-play goals (on 105 chances), 29th in the NHL.
- The Capitals score on 15.24% of their power plays, No. 28 in the league.
- Washington has scored one shorthanded goal (24th in league).
